Generally I would think the best way to approach a boss would be to spread your mages out, pop all cooldowns and then open with your biggest, slowest casting spell. Then spam fireball or frostbolt. Ice block and the boss will run to another character. Repeat. As frost you get 2 ice blocks with cold snap plus BoP with the paladin. Some bosses are even able to be slowed so your frostbolt will do work.

Once you get a decent amount of spell damage I suppose you could try an arcane/fire build with PoM and pyroblast and see if 8 pyros plus a fireblast is enough damage to kill a boss.
800ish base damage
~300ish spell/fire damage
10% damage from talents
30% damage from AP
That's around 13000 with no crits from pyro and another 2800ish from fire blast. So like 15000 damage all up assuming average fire resist. Emperor Thaurissan, last boss in BRD, has around 26,649 HP.
I'm thinking using frost and bouncing the boss around with invulns would be more viable. Either way seems like, bosses with add spawns or other mechanics would give you trouble.
